What Are Forex Signals?
Forex signals are trade recommendations shared by professional traders, algorithms, or trading groups.
A signal usually includes:
- Currency pair
- Buy/Sell direction
- Entry price
- Stop loss
- Take profit
Example:
- Buy EUR/USD at 1.0850
- Stop Loss: 1.0800
- Take Profit: 1.0950
Instead of placing these trades manually, traders now use signal copier software to automate the process.
How Does Forex Signal Copying Work?
Signal copying works through automation.
When a signal provider opens a trade, the copier software instantly replicates it into connected accounts.
Basic workflow
- Signal provider executes trade
- Copier software detects the trade
- Trade is copied automatically
- SL/TP updates synchronize in real time
This process reduces manual errors and improves execution speed significantly.

How to Copy Forex Signals on MT4
MT4 remains one of the most widely used forex platforms globally.
Setting up signal copying on MT4 is relatively straightforward.
Step-by-step MT4 setup
- Install MT4 platform
- Download forex signal copier EA
- Add EA to MT4 Experts folder
- Enable AutoTrading
- Connect master/slave settings
- Configure risk management
Important MT4 settings
- Lot size scaling
- Maximum drawdown limits
- Allowed currency pairs
- Slippage tolerance
Always test setups on demo accounts first.
That step gets skipped too often.

Choosing the Best Forex Signal Provider
The copier matters.
But the signal provider matters even more.
Things to evaluate
- Verified trading history
- Consistent risk management
- Drawdown history
- Risk-to-reward ratio
- Trading frequency
Avoid providers promising:
- “Guaranteed profits”
- Unrealistic monthly returns
- Extremely aggressive leverage
That usually ends badly.
Why VPS Hosting Matters for Copy Trading
Many beginners run copy trading systems directly from home PCs.
That creates problems:
- Internet disconnections
- Platform shutdowns
- Power failures
- Delayed execution
Benefits of VPS hosting
- 24/7 uptime
- Faster execution
- Better stability
- Reduced latency
Serious copy trading setups almost always use VPS infrastructure.

Common Mistakes Beginners Make
Most copy trading problems come from poor setup decisions.
Common mistakes
- Copying high-risk traders blindly
- Overleveraging accounts
- Ignoring drawdown history
- Using unstable copier software
- Not testing on demo first
Good risk management still matters—even with automation.
Maybe even more.
